Summary

Allows counties to provide assessment reduction for portions of homestead property used as living quarters for property owner's parent or grandparent who is 62 years of age or older & removes current provisions limiting reduction to increases in assessments resulting from construction or reconstruction of such living quarters & limiting amount of such reduction.
